Understanding Expanded Mesh Metal Versatility and Applications
Expanded mesh metal, often referred to simply as expanded metal, is a versatile material known for its unique properties and a wide range of applications. Created by cutting and stretching a metal sheet, expanded metals maintain a lightweight structure while providing impressive strength and durability. Characteristics of Expanded Mesh Metal
One of the defining features of expanded mesh metal is its distinctive pattern, formed by regular diamond-shaped openings. This structural design not only enhances its aesthetic appeal but also provides functionality. The open spaces between the mesh enable air circulation and light penetration while still offering security and protection. The mesh can be produced from various metals, including aluminum, stainless steel, and carbon steel, each possessing unique qualities such as corrosion resistance and tensile strength.
Another notable attribute of expanded metal is its lightweight nature. Despite having a minimal weight, expanded mesh can bear substantial loads, making it suitable for various construction uses. Additionally, the surface of expanded mesh offers excellent slip resistance, making it an ideal choice for flooring installations in both industrial and commercial settings.
Manufacturing Process
The manufacturing of expanded mesh metal involves a precise series of steps. Initially, a flat sheet of metal is fed into a machine that cuts slits into the metal surface. The slits are strategically spaced to create the characteristic diamond pattern. Once the cutting is completed, the sheet is then stretched and expanded. This expansion process increases the area of the sheet and transforms it into the final mesh product. The result is a material that is both cost-effective and incredibly efficient for diverse applications.
The expansion ratio can vary, allowing manufacturers to customize the product based on specific needs. Depending on the intended use, the size of the openings and the thickness of the metal can be adjusted, offering a realm of possibilities for tailored designs.
Applications of Expanded Mesh Metal

Expanded mesh metal finds a myriad of applications across different sectors due to its strength, durability, and unique properties.
1. Construction and Architecture In the construction industry, expanded metal is utilized for purposes such as fencing, safety barriers, and as a component of ceilings and wall panels. Its ability to provide structural support while allowing airflow makes it a popular choice for building facades and ventilation systems.
2. Industrial Use Many factories and warehouses use expanded metal for walkways, platforms, and stair treads due to its slip-resistant surface. It can also serve as guards and screens, protecting machinery and personnel while allowing visibility.
3. Agricultural Applications Farmers and agricultural workers employ expanded mesh to create enclosures for livestock, as it provides security while still being lightweight and easy to manipulate. Additionally, the mesh can be used for sunshades and pest control screens.
4. Arts and Crafts The aesthetic potential of expanded metal has also captured the interest of artists and designers. It can be repurposed for creating sculptures, light fixtures, and decorative installations. The unique interplay of light through the mesh adds an intriguing dimension to artistic expression.
5. Automotive and Aerospace In the automotive sector, expanded mesh is used for grilles, vents, and decorative elements. Its lightweight yet strong nature is also a boon in aerospace applications, where reducing weight without compromising structural integrity is crucial.
